FileExist (Magic xpa 3.x)

Checks whether a specified file or folder exists on a drive, and returns a Boolean (TRUE,FALSE).

Syntax:

FileExist(file name)

Parameters:

file name – An Alpha string that represents the file or folder name. The string may contain a path. If the path is not indicated, Magic xpa assumes the current directory.

Returns:

Boolean – TRUE or FALSE

Example:

FileExist('c:\magic\magic.ini') returns TRUE if the Magic.ini file exists in the C:\MAGIC directory.

Note:

If the path ends with a backslash (\), the function may return blank. It is recommended not to include the backslash at the end of the path.
